I do understand everyone's Concepts when it comes to the Forgiveness of Jesus from the cross.
For myself what I see based on the writings of Paul and everything else in Scripture it leads me to understand that the death of Jesus on the cross wipes the Slate for everyone when they accept Jesus as Lord. At that moment you're at 100% perfect before God.
But as we are human we fall we do stupid stupid stuff all the time. You know you look at a billboard the wrong way bam a stupid sin because maybe it's some stupid lust for half a second but it's still a sin. Or maybe you swear because some idiot cut you off driving their car. Or maybe it's a different kind of sin like you see a situation developing and all you have to do is get out and help that person and stop them from doing something stupid themselves. But instead of doing that instead of getting involved you decide not to. In a manner you have become an accessory to the sin that you knew was going to be committed by that person. Even though you yourself didn't commit the sin, the holy spirit is the one that got you to realize that this guy is about to sin. But because you denied the movement of the spirit in you now you've become a accessory to the sin that that other person committed.
There are all sorts of craziness in the world. And being human guess what we're knee deep in it. But you have to repent. Lord I'm sorry I swore because this guy cut me off I'm sorry Lord please forgive me and be sincere about it. And guess what you're forgiven
But let us say that you've been doing all these things and you've never repented and now you die. You're still a child of God, you're still part of the family not God's not going to toss you into the fire because of all these stupid little sins but yet you're not perfect still to go to heaven you still have sins on your soul that need to be corrected. And this is how I see Purgatory as actually being a part of Heaven cleansing us from what needs to be removed so that we can enjoy heaven with God
